How do we get most of our petroleum? a) Mining

b) Drilling and extraction from underground reservoirs
c) Manufacturing synthetic petroleum in laboratories
d) Importing from other countries

Most of our petroleum is obtained through drilling and extraction from underground reservoirs. Drilling rigs are used to drill deep into the Earth's crust to reach the underground reservoirs where petroleum is trapped. Once the drill reaches the reservoir, the petroleum is extracted and brought to the surface for refining and processing.
